Physical properties
Hardness: 6.5-7 on the Mohs scale. Color: Reddish-brown, orange-tan, ochre. Luster: Earthy, dull to sub-vitreous. Cleavage: None (conchoidal fracture). Specific Gravity: ~2.6-2.65.
Formation & geological history
Formed via chemical precipitation of microcrystalline quartz in sedimentary environments or low-grade metamorphism, heavily stained by secondary iron oxides (hematite/goethite).
Uses & applications
Used primarily for landscaping, decorative stone, tumbled specimens, lapidary cabochons, and historically for flintknapping primitive tools.
Geological facts
Iron-rich jasper and chert are among the most widespread microcrystalline quartz varieties on Earth. Red and brown hues are directly caused by hydrated iron oxides.
Field identification & locations
Look for a smooth, waxy to earthy texture, high hardness (scratches glass, cannot be scratched by a steel pocketknife), and distinct reddish-orange to brown iron staining. Common in stream beds, gravel pits, and sedimentary rock outcrops.
